NUCLEAR REGULATORY COMMISSION
[Docket No. 52-033]
Detroit Edison Company Acceptance for Docketing of an Application
for Combined License (Col) for FERMI 3
On September 18, 2008, the U.S.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C,
the Commission) received a combined license (COL) application from
Detroit Edison Company, dated September 18, 2008, filed pursuant to
Section 103 of the Atomic Energy Act and Subpart C of Part 52,
``Licenses, Certifications, and Approvals for Nuclear Power Plants,''
of Title 10 of the Code of Federal Regulations (10 CFR Part 52). The
site location is in Monroe County, Michigan and identified as Fermi 3.
A notice of receipt and availability of this application was previously
published in the Federal Register (73 FR 61916 on October 17, 2008).
The NRC staff has determined that Detroit Edison Company has
submitted information in accordance with 10 CFR Part 2, ``Rules of
Practice for Domestic Licensing Proceedings and Issuance of Orders,''
and Part 52 that is sufficiently complete and acceptable for docketing.
The docket number established for this application is 52-033.
The NRC staff will perform a detailed technical review of the
application. Docketing of the COL application does not preclude the NRC
from requesting additional information from the applicant as the review
proceeds, nor does it predict whether the Commission will grant or deny
the application. The Commission will conduct a hearing in accordance
with Subpart L of 10 CFR Part 2; the notice of hearing and opportunity
to intervene will be published at a later date. The Commission will
receive a report on the application from the Advisory Committee on
Reactor Safeguards in accordance with 10 CFR 52.87. If the Commission
finds that the application meets the applicable standards of the Atomic
Energy Act and the Commission's regulations, and that required
notifications to other agencies and bodies have been made, the
Commission will issue a COL, in the form and containing conditions and
limitations that the Commission finds appropriate and necessary.
